Immediate no-writer purge with auto-dispose turned off
Rule 28 · applies to publisher and subscriber matching · Back to all rules
Breaks a guarantee. Samples are purged the instant a writer goes not-alive, before the intended dispose-based cleanup can run.
- Settings involved: Writer Data Lifecycle and Reader Data Lifecycle
- What QoS Guard checks:
[W.autodispose = FALSE] ∧ [R.autopurge_nowriter = 0]
Example
With auto-dispose off and a zero no-writer delay, a brief writer dropout wipes the reader's cache immediately.
How to fix it
Use a non-zero no-writer purge delay, or enable auto-dispose so cleanup is driven by dispose rather than by writer liveliness.
Why this rule is flagged
What the DDS specification says
| OMG DDS § | QoS policy | Standard statement |
|---|---|---|
| §2.2.3.21 | WRITER_DATA_LIFECYCLE | If autodispose_unregistered_instances is false, unregistering a writer does not dispose the instance. |
| §2.2.3.22 | READER_DATA_LIFECYCLE | autopurge_nowriter_samples_delay defines how long a DataReader maintains information for an instance once its state becomes NOT_ALIVE_NO_WRITERS. |
| §2.2.2.5.1.3 | Instance state | NOT_ALIVE_NO_WRITERS indicates that there are no live DataWriter entities writing the instance. |

What you'll see when you run it
QoS Guard reports this mismatch as a functional conflict:
[FUNCTIONAL] W.autodispose=FALSE <-> R.autopurge_nowriter=0. Samples may never be purged when all writers disappear.
At runtime the reader treats a writer going not-alive as the trigger to reclaim its instances, and a zero no-writer delay reclaims them immediately. Because auto-dispose is off, those instances were never disposed, so the dispose-based cleanup you intended never runs. A brief writer dropout then wipes the reader's cache at once, breaking the retention you expected.
